Michael Lee Hughes, 90, of North Vernon, passed away at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day, January 20, 2026, at Majestic Care of North Vernon.

Born December 5, 1935, in Grant County, Indiana, he was the son of the late Loval and Mildred (Parson) Hughes. He married Wilma Mae (Branham) Hughes on April 22, 1956, at the Weston Baptist Church in Jennings County; she preceded him in death on March 1, 2018.

Michael was a 1954 graduate of Paris Crossing High School. He worked maintenance for Cummins Engine Company for 36 years retiring in 1990, after retirement he mowed lawns. Michael was the former owner of Kimberly Lake. He was a member of Tea Creek Baptist Church, Gideon’s International, and Promise Keeper. Michael enjoyed fishing, visiting with friends and shut ins.
